    I keep forgetting to say......

    I don't know how everyone is labelling their blocks (or even if people are) but I tossed around a few ideas and settled on a fabric pen... I've been writing the name of the block (A1, B2, etc) on the back on one of the seam allowances. So no chance of it showing through, and no chance of it falling off (like stickers), and it's not going to use up all my pins either! :-)
